My husband's grandfather, George W. Hullett, died in Ellis County, Texas in
October, 1916 from typhoid fever. His whole family had it but even though
he had it he never went to bed with it so he could take care of the children
and save their lives. Consequently, he got pneumonia from it and died.
Back in those days they didn't have water that came to them from treatment
plants. They got their water from a well or from a spring and that is where
the typhoid fever gets started from. The Hullett famliy got the typhoid
from their water source.
